How do you extract sound from SF2?

If you want to extract WAV files from an SF2, here is a way to start:

  1. Install sfZed (windows).
  2. File > Import Soundfont, then choose your SF2 file.
  3. File > Save As, then save it as SFZ. Choose Save the samples> Yes.
  4. You’ll have the WAV files in the output folder!

How do I convert 24 bit to 16 bit WAV?

In the General Preferences tab, click on Import Settings, located towards the bottom. Click on the menu next to Import Using > WAV Encoder. Then click to change Setting > Custom and a new window will open. In the WAV Encoder window, change the Sample Rate to 44.100 kHz and Sample Size to 16-bit.

What is an SFZ Player?

sforzando is a free, highly SFZ 2.0 compliant sample player. Advanced sample hobbyists now have a powerful tool to experiment and share instruments without relying on proprietary formats. sforzando has only one instrument slot; no fancy UI, effects or mixers.

Can I upload 24-bit to TuneCore?

Other than CD Baby, the rest of the main digital distributors such as DistroKid, The Orchard, and TuneCore all accept 24-bit WAV files, and they can be higher sample rate files than 44.1k if available from the mastering session.

Is 16-bit or 24-bit better?

Audio resolution, measured in bits Similarly, 24-bit audio can record 16,777,216 discreet values for loudness levels (or a dynamic range of 144 dB), versus 16-bit audio which can represent 65,536 discrete values for the loudness levels (or a dynamic range of 96 dB).

Is WAV a lossy audio format?

WAV is an extension/ a format to save the audio files. It is an application (subset) of Resource Interchange File Format (RIFF) for storing digital audio files. The WAV has a close resemblance with 8SVX and AIFF formats. The WAV file format has been, and it still is, the best standard format for audio CDs. WAV files are lossless and uncompressed.

Does Converting FLAC to WAV Lose Quality? Both WAV and FLAC are lossless audio formats. It means that converting FLAC to WAV or vice versa won’t lose audio quality.

    What is the difference between WAV and FLAC?

    Difference between FLAC and WAV. The first thing that is different between these two is that FLAC is the compressed format and WAV is an uncompressed original audio format. FLAC as the compressed format is mostly used to make sure that the audio file occupies less space. Whereas WAV will take much more space compared to FLAC.
